Before turning on the power supply
IMPORTANT SAFETY INSTRUCTIONS
Warning: Read these pages carefully to ensure safe operation of the device.
R ! ead this advice carefully
- Follow the safety and operating instructions when using this device.
Keep these instructions somewhere safe!
- Keep these instructions for safety and operation in a safe place.
Pay attention to all warnings!
- You should carefully follow all operating instructions and warnings provided for this product.
1. Only clean the device ! with a clean, dry cloth
- . Pull out the plug on the device from the socket before cleaning When cleaning, never use liquid detergents
or cleaning sprays, only a damp cloth.
2. Accessories
- . Only use accessories provided by the manufacturer
3. Never use this device near water
- – The device should never be used near water droplets or sprays for example, near bathrooms, washbasins,
the kitchen sink, . washing machine, in a damp cellar or near a swimming pool etc Never place receptacles full of
fluid on top of the device, for example, vases of flowers.
4. Ventilation
- - The slits and openings in the housing are designed to ventilate the device to ensure it works reliably and to
protect it from overheating and potentially bursting into flames. Do not block the ventilation holes. Install the
device according to the manufacturer's instructions. Never block the ventilation holes by placing the device on a
bed, sofa, rug, or similar soft surface. The device in cupboard if should not be installed in a bookcase or built-
there is insufficient ventilation, . as described in the manufacturer’s installation guide
5. Power supply
- This device can only be connected to the mains power voltage specified on the device. If you are not sure
about the type of power supply in your home, contact your dealer or your local energy provider.
6. Power cable
- Make sure nobody can trip over the power cable and that, if near a socket, it cannot become trapped by
additional sockets. Never crush the power cord that protrudes from the . device
7. Storms
- Disconnect the device from the power supply if there is a storm or if it is not being used for a long period of
time.
8. Overloading
- Never overload mains sockets, extension cables or multiple socket outlets as this could lead to a risk of fire or
electric shock.
9. The ingress of foreign bodies or fluids
- Make sure that no foreign bodies or fluids can get into this device through the ventilation holes, as these
could make contact with high-voltage components or cause a short-circuit, leading to a fire or electric shock.
Never spill any kind of liquid . on this device
